Exploring Marseille’s Apéro Culture

Typical Marseille Bistronomy Food Tour - Exploring Marseilles Apéro Culture

Although Marseille’s bustling port and picturesque Old Town are renowned attractions, the city’s vibrant apéro culture offers visitors a unique glimpse into the local way of life.

The apéro, a social gathering for pre-dinner drinks and light snacks, reflects the French’s appreciation for enjoying life’s simple pleasures with friends and family.

During the tour, guests indulge in a variety of local wines, Mediterranean flavors, and iconic French delicacies, all while exploring iconic venues and taking in stunning views of the Old Port.

This enriching experience showcases the importance of the apéro tradition in Marseille’s lively food scene.

Diverse Food and Beverage Offerings

A highlight of the Marseille Bistronomy Food Tour is the diverse array of food and beverage offerings that immerse participants in the city’s vibrant culinary landscape.

The tour features:

  1. A tasting of local Provençal rosé and Pastis, the quintessential anise-flavored apéritif that reflects Marseille’s easygoing lifestyle.

  2. Savory panisses, a signature chickpea fritter, and an assortment of charcuterie that showcase the region’s Mediterranean flavors.

  3. Fresh olive oil, fragrant garlic, and seasonal vegetables that highlight the tour’s focus on high-quality, locally-sourced ingredients.

Significance of Apéro in French Culture

Typical Marseille Bistronomy Food Tour - Significance of Apéro in French Culture

Deeply rooted in French culture, the apéro tradition reflects the country’s cherished values of enjoying life’s simple pleasures in the company of friends and family.

This convivial ritual serves as a bridge between the workday and the evening meal, allowing people to unwind and connect over a glass of wine and light bites.
